SMART/Health Status イベントの種類を示す値が含まれています。
構文
typedef enum {
NVME_ASYNC_HEALTH_NVM_SUBSYSTEM_RELIABILITY,
NVME_ASYNC_HEALTH_TEMPERATURE_THRESHOLD,
NVME_ASYNC_HEALTH_SPARE_BELOW_THRESHOLD
} NVME_ASYNC_EVENT_HEALTH_STATUS_CODES;
定数
NVME_ASYNC_HEALTH_NVM_SUBSYSTEM_RELIABILITY NVM サブシステムの信頼性が損なわれています。 これは、重大なメディア エラー、内部エラー、読み取り専用モードのメディア、または揮発性メモリ バックアップ デバイスの障害が原因である可能性があります。 |
NVME_ASYNC_HEALTH_TEMPERATURE_THRESHOLD 温度が温度のしきい値を超えているか、温度が低いしきい値を下回ります。 |
NVME_ASYNC_HEALTH_SPARE_BELOW_THRESHOLD 使用可能な予備スペースがしきい値を下回っています。 |
備考
非同期イベント要求管理コマンドで使用される NVME_ASYNC_EVENT_TYPES 列挙体の NVME_ASYNC_EVENT_TYPE_HEALTH_STATUS フィールドに値を指定するには、この列挙体を使用します。
必要条件
要件 | 価値 |
---|---|
サポートされる最小クライアント | Windows 10 |
ヘッダー | nvme.h |